How to: Set Up Club Attributes

Every member club can have its own set of attributes. Attributes are extra information about the club's members. Some functions, Member Campaigns and Offers, for example, make use of the attributes for statistics and as triggers for offers and promotions. There are different types of attributes and they have different lookup types.

To set up attributes for club members

  1. Click the icon, enter Member Attribute, and select the relevant link.
  2. This page shows an overview of all attributes that you can specify for the club's members.
  3. Click the New action menu to specify a new set of attributes for the members in a club..
  4. Fill in the fields as described in the following table.
    FieldDescription
    CodeThis is the unique identifier for an attribute.
    DescriptionHere you can enter a description of the attribute.
    Visible TypeThe available options here are:
    Private. This attribute is displayed in the member's Loyalty app or in eCommerce when the member is viewing the account information.
    System. This attribute is not displayed in the member's Loyalty app or in eCommerce when the member is viewing the account information.
    Linked ToThe options here are Account, Contact, or Both. Depending on how you choose, the attribute will be available on the Member Account card, the Member Contact card, or on both cards.
    Attribute TypeThe available options are:
    Text. Use this type for text or code fields.
    Integer. Only integer numbers can be used.
    Decimal. The input must be numeric.
    Date. The input must be a valid date.
    Boolean. The input can be 0, 1, YES, NO, FALSE, TRUE.
    Lookup TypeThis field validates the input and provides lookup options. The lookup options are:
    None. No lookup or validation. The system will only validate the attribute type.
    Options. All valid inputs are inserted into the Member Attribute Lookup table (click Lookup Setup on the Related action menu.
    Range. This works the same way as Options, but the Attribute Lookup Table will only include 2 records, the lowest and the highest valid values. It is, for example, possible to have two entries, 1 and 99. This would allow all values between 1 and 99.
    Table. This will result in a lookup in the table you specify in the Table Setup ID column.
    Auto. Transfer. When you select this type, you must select the transfer from a table and which field you want to transfer. The transfer will be automatically maintained by the system.
    Dynamic Query. This lookup type is linked to a Dynamic Query. When the query runs, it will return a value, and that value will be the attribute value.
    Campaign. A system attribute. This lookup type is inserted automatically when you create a member campaign. The type has the same ID as the campaign.
    Table Setup ID You can only use this field if the lookup type is Table. Here you specify which dynamic lookup you wish to use to validate the input and lookup of values.
    Transfer from TableYou can only use this field if the lookup type is Auto. Transfer. Here you specify the table you want to transfer from. The options are:
    Member Account, Member Contact, and NAV Contact.
    Transfer Field IDThe number of the field you want to transfer automatically to the attribute table.
    MandatoryIf you select this check box, the system will automatically display the attributes in the Attribute Setup on the Member Account and Member Contact cards. The value specified in the Missing Attribute Handling field on the Member Management Setup card determines whether the system will display a warning or an error message if this attribute is not filled in.
    Allow BlankYou can only edit this field when the Lookup Type is None. This attribute tells the system whether the attribute value can be left blank.
    Default ValueIf you want the system to set an initial value when a record is inserted, you should specify this value here.
    Test InputThis field is only used to test the setup. Here you can test both the lookup and the validation of the input. This will work the same way as it does in the system.

The actions on the Member Attribute card let you work even further with member attributes. The Related action menu contains the Lookup SetupClosed A lookup type can be Option or Range. If it is Option, the system only accepts input to the Member Attribute Values that are specified here. If the lookup type is Range, the system will accept all values between the two values specified here, including Start and End., Dynamic QueryClosed When the lookup type is Dynamic Query, you must fill in the Query form. The result from this attribute type is not saved in the Attribute Entry table, instead it is calculated dynamically from the data in the system., Valid in ClubsClosed Here you can specify where this attribute can be used. You can limit its use to one or more clubs (via Attribute Setup on the Club Card)., and Attribute EntryClosed Opens a form showing all member attribute entries that have been created for each attribute. actions (click the Attribute menu).